1 menu "MMC Host controller Support"
2
3 config MMC
4 bool "MMC/SD/SDIO card support"
5 default ARM || PPC || SANDBOX
6 help
7 This selects MultiMediaCard, Secure Digital and Secure
8 Digital I/O support.
9
10 If you want MMC/SD/SDIO support, you should say Y here and
11 also to your specific host controller driver.
12
13 config MMC_WRITE
14 bool "support for MMC/SD write operations"
15 depends on MMC
16 default y
17 help
18 Enable write access to MMC and SD Cards
19
20 config MMC_BROKEN_CD
21 bool "Poll for broken card detection case"
22 help
23 If card detection feature is broken, just poll to detect.
24
25 config DM_MMC
26 bool "Enable MMC controllers using Driver Model"
27 depends on DM
28 help
29 This enables the MultiMediaCard (MMC) uclass which supports MMC and
30 Secure Digital I/O (SDIO) cards. Both removable (SD, micro-SD, etc.)
31 and non-removable (e.g. eMMC chip) devices are supported. These
32 appear as block devices in U-Boot and can support filesystems such
33 as EXT4 and FAT.
34
35 config SPL_DM_MMC
36 bool "Enable MMC controllers using Driver Model in SPL"
37 depends on SPL_DM && DM_MMC
38 default y
39 help
40 This enables the MultiMediaCard (MMC) uclass which supports MMC and
41 Secure Digital I/O (SDIO) cards. Both removable (SD, micro-SD, etc.)
42 and non-removable (e.g. eMMC chip) devices are supported. These
43 appear as block devices in U-Boot and can support filesystems such
44 as EXT4 and FAT.
45

57 config MMC_QUIRKS
58 bool "Enable quirks"
59 default y
60 help
61 Some cards and hosts may sometimes behave unexpectedly (quirks).
62 This option enable workarounds to handle those quirks. Some of them
63 are enabled by default, other may require additionnal flags or are
64 enabled by the host driver.
65
66 config MMC_HW_PARTITIONING
67 bool "Support for HW partitioning command(eMMC)"
68 default y
69 help
70 This adds a command and an API to do hardware partitioning on eMMC
71 devices.
72
73 config MMC_IO_VOLTAGE
74 bool "Support IO voltage configuration"
75 help
76 IO voltage configuration allows selecting the voltage level of the IO
77 lines (not the level of main supply). This is required for UHS
78 support. For eMMC this not mandatory, but not enabling this option may
79 prevent the driver of using the faster modes.
80
81 config SPL_MMC_IO_VOLTAGE
82 bool "Support IO voltage configuration in SPL"
83 default n
84 help
85 IO voltage configuration allows selecting the voltage level of the IO
86 lines (not the level of main supply). This is required for UHS
87 support. For eMMC this not mandatory, but not enabling this option may
88 prevent the driver of using the faster modes.
89
90 config MMC_UHS_SUPPORT
91 bool "enable UHS support"
92 depends on MMC_IO_VOLTAGE
93 help
94 The Ultra High Speed (UHS) bus is available on some SDHC and SDXC
95 cards. The IO voltage must be switchable from 3.3v to 1.8v. The bus
96 frequency can go up to 208MHz (SDR104)
97
98 config SPL_MMC_UHS_SUPPORT
99 bool "enable UHS support in SPL"
100 depends on SPL_MMC_IO_VOLTAGE
101 help
102 The Ultra High Speed (UHS) bus is available on some SDHC and SDXC
103 cards. The IO voltage must be switchable from 3.3v to 1.8v. The bus
104 frequency can go up to 208MHz (SDR104)
105
106 config MMC_HS200_SUPPORT
107 bool "enable HS200 support"
108 help
109 The HS200 mode is support by some eMMC. The bus frequency is up to
110 200MHz. This mode requires tuning the IO.
111
112
113 config SPL_MMC_HS200_SUPPORT
114 bool "enable HS200 support in SPL"
115 help
116 The HS200 mode is support by some eMMC. The bus frequency is up to
117 200MHz. This mode requires tuning the IO.
118
119 config MMC_VERBOSE
120 bool "Output more information about the MMC"
121 default y
122 help
123 Enable the output of more information about the card such as the
124 operating mode.
125
126 config SPL_MMC_TINY
127 bool "Tiny MMC framework in SPL"
128 help
129 Enable MMC framework tinification support. This option is useful if
130 if your SPL is extremely size constrained. Heed the warning, enable
131 this option if and only if you know exactly what you are doing, if
132 you are reading this help text, you most likely have no idea :-)
133
134 The MMC framework is reduced to bare minimum to be useful. No malloc
135 support is needed for the MMC framework operation with this option
136 enabled. The framework supports exactly one MMC device and exactly
137 one MMC driver. The MMC driver can be adjusted to avoid any malloc
138 operations too, which can remove the need for malloc support in SPL
139 and thus further reduce footprint.

150 config MMC_DW
151 bool "Synopsys DesignWare Memory Card Interface"
152 help
153 This selects support for the Synopsys DesignWare Mobile Storage IP
154 block, this provides host support for SD and MMC interfaces, in both
155 PIO, internal DMA mode and external DMA mode.
156
157 config MMC_DW_EXYNOS
158 bool "Exynos specific extensions for Synopsys DW Memory Card Interface"
159 depends on ARCH_EXYNOS
160 depends on MMC_DW
161 default y
162 help
163 This selects support for Samsung Exynos SoC specific extensions to the
164 Synopsys DesignWare Memory Card Interface driver. Select this option
165 for platforms based on Exynos4 and Exynos5 SoC's.
166
167 config MMC_DW_K3
168 bool "K3 specific extensions for Synopsys DW Memory Card Interface"
169 depends on MMC_DW
170 help
171 This selects support for Hisilicon K3 SoC specific extensions to the
172 Synopsys DesignWare Memory Card Interface driver. Select this option
173 for platforms based on Hisilicon K3 SoC's.
174
175 config MMC_DW_ROCKCHIP
176 bool "Rockchip SD/MMC controller support"
177 depends on DM_MMC && OF_CONTROL
178 depends on MMC_DW
179 help
180 This enables support for the Rockchip SD/MMM controller, which is
181 based on Designware IP. The device is compatible with at least
182 SD 3.0, SDIO 3.0 and MMC 4.5 and supports common eMMC chips as well
183 as removeable SD and micro-SD cards.

306 config MMC_SDHCI_SDMA
307 bool "Support SDHCI SDMA"
308 depends on MMC_SDHCI
309 help
310 This enables support for the SDMA (Single Operation DMA) defined
311 in the SD Host Controller Standard Specification Version 1.00 .
312
313 config MMC_SDHCI_ATMEL
314 bool "Atmel SDHCI controller support"
315 depends on ARCH_AT91
316 depends on DM_MMC && BLK && ARCH_AT91
317 depends on MMC_SDHCI
318 help
319 This enables support for the Atmel SDHCI controller, which supports
320 the embedded MultiMedia Card (e.MMC) Specification V4.51, the SD
321 Memory Card Specification V3.0, and the SDIO V3.0 specification.
322 It is compliant with the SD Host Controller Standard V3.0
323 specification.

360 config MMC_SDHCI_MSM
361 bool "Qualcomm SDHCI controller"
362 depends on BLK && DM_MMC
363 depends on MMC_SDHCI
364 help
365 Enables support for SDHCI 2.0 controller present on some Qualcomm
366 Snapdragon devices. This device is compatible with eMMC v4.5 and
367 SD 3.0 specifications. Both SD and eMMC devices are supported.
368 Card-detect gpios are not supported.

482 config GENERIC_ATMEL_MCI
483 bool "Atmel Multimedia Card Interface support"
484 depends on DM_MMC && BLK && ARCH_AT91
485 help
486 This enables support for Atmel High Speed Multimedia Card Interface
487 (HSMCI), which supports the MultiMedia Card (MMC) Specification V4.3,
488 the SD Memory Card Specification V2.0, the SDIO V2.0 specification
489 and CE-ATA V1.1.
